>Just need a confirmation if there is any problem attempting to do so on a
>Raq2.

Works fine on my Raq2 with only 32mb of ram (VERY light load, minimal sql
hits), but to run the latest versions, you'll want to compile from source.
Install php 4.0.3 (NOT 4.0.4), and I highly recommend mySQL 3.23.
